Understanding the Basics: Table Linens

Before you begin setting the table, ensure you have the right linens. A tablecloth should cover the entire table, with a minimum of 12 inches of overhang on all sides. A placemat should be used if a tablecloth is not being used, and it should be large enough to accommodate the place setting. Napkins can be folded in various ways, depending on the desired look and the type of cuisine being served.

Setting the Table: The Place Setting

The place setting is the heart of the table, and it's crucial to understand the order of placement. Start from the outside and work your way in. The first item to place is the charger, a decorative plate that adds elegance and can be removed before serving the meal. Next, place the dinner plate, then the salad plate on top of the dinner plate. On the right side of the plate setting, place the dinner knife, with the blade facing the plate, followed by the spoon, then the teaspoon. On the left side, place the dinner fork, then the salad fork. The dessert utensils, if used, go above the plate.

Glassware and Silverware Placement

Glassware should be placed above and slightly to the right of the dinner knife. The order of glassware from left to right is usually water, white wine, red wine, and champagne. Silverware used for the meal is placed on the left side of the plate, with the order of use from the outside in. Dessert silverware, if used, goes above the plate.

Setting the Table for Specific Occasions

Depending on the occasion, the table setting may vary. For a formal dinner, consider using a threefold napkin fold, a charger, and multiple forks and spoons. For a casual meal, a simple fold for the napkin, no charger, and fewer utensils will suffice. For a buffet-style meal, consider using placemats and a simple place setting.

Table Decor: The Finishing Touches

Once the place setting is complete, it's time to add the finishing touches. A centerpiece can add a touch of elegance, but be mindful not to block the view of the guests across the table. Candles, flowers, or a simple bowl of fruit can all make beautiful centerpieces. Don't forget to consider the height of the centerpiece to ensure it doesn't obstruct conversation. Finally, ensure the table is well-lit, using candles or overhead lighting to create a warm and inviting atmosphere.

Table Setting for Special Dietary Needs

It's essential to cater to guests with special dietary needs. Clearly label dishes that contain common allergens, and consider providing separate dishes for guests with dietary restrictions. If a guest has a severe allergy, ensure their utensils and plate are clearly marked to avoid cross-contamination.
